To provide a drone that has a built-in balloon inside the drone and uses the buoyant force to fly the drone up in the air where the air is thin.SOLUTION: A drone 1 includes: a shrunk built-in balloon 2; and a balloon filler gas cylinder 3 for inflating the balloon by opening a gas-filling valve 4 to support buoyant force of the drone when intending to bring the drone to a higher altitude. When causing the drone to descend, opening a gas-releasing valve 5 discharges a gas filled in the balloon. Opening the gas-filling valve 4 can prevent falling in emergency.SELECTED DRAWING: Figure 1
